About Us

Parlor Room Theater Company is a registered 501(c)(3) non-profit organization located and performing in the Washington, D.C. area.

Our Mission

Parlor Room Theater is committed to making quality theater that is affordable and accessible.

Beginnings

Parlor Room Theater began in the summer of 2006 with the DiSalvo brothers getting their friends together and putting on a play. It was named “Parlor Room” because the first audition was held in a living room, and “Living Room Theater” did not have much of a ring to it.

We’re committed to putting on quality productions while keeping our ticket price low. Attending a play with your family or a group of friends shouldn’t be a splurge that you make once or twice a year; it should be affordable enough that you want to go again and again. Anyone can buy a ticket to our shows for only $15. You’d be hard pressed to find a cheaper ticket in town.

Most of all, we think it’s important to have fun with theater and put on plays that we love.
